The Government of Italy - through its Ministry of Economic Development - and Alibaba Group announced that it has signed a memorandum of understanding (MOU) to foster greater trade opportunities for Italian businesses seeking to sell to the vast Chinese consumer market via Alibaba Group's Tmall.com and Tmall.hk online retail platforms (collectively, "Tmall") and other related Group businesses. During the three-year term under the MOU, Alibaba Group will, among other things, provide Italian enterprises with express enrolment support for Tmall and its dedicated services, and as well as online promotion and marketing support on the platforms. The Ministry of Economic Development of the Italian Republic will, among other things, work with Alibaba Group to help Italian companies understand the opportunities in China and its unique Chinese consumers by leveraging Tmall's experience and product category data. This collaboration will also provide Tmall with Italian retail trends and popularity guidance to make marketing campaigns more focused and effective for Chinese consumers.

Alibaba Group will also explore collaboration possibilities with Italian companies via its other business units such as business-to-business platform, Alibaba.com, as well as the related payment business Alipay and the affiliated logistics business China Smart Logistics.
